:D :D :D Here is a hint for the red spheres.
Once you get the gen going and the spheres rolling wait and when the bridge is complete to the coin right of the green button push the plasma cube up to stop the next sphere.

Once that is done push the cube onto the red button.

Now go and collect that coin and step on the green button then step down pushing the sphere inside the cube in the bot area down into the water then when its safe push that cube up and to the right of the green button to act as a stopper for the red spheres.

Now push that sphere you stopped up into the water hole there then run left and stand below the spot where the sphere will stop then build that bridge then the bridge up top (you must run down every time you push one of the two sphere needed to build the top bridge) then push the barrel down to the left of the box.

Now go back down push the sphere down into the bonus coin that you didn't collect yet and when its safe push it up then right so it hits the barrel.

After you push the sphere to the barrel you must run down before the newly generated sphere arrives.

The last sphere generated is for the pink button.
